【error C2512】VC++编译错误 no appropriate default constructor available
来源:互联网 发布:java的逻辑或怎么打 编辑:程序博客网 时间:2024/05/16 07:40
转载请注明出处
由于阅历有限,篇幅不周之处还望指出,谢谢
如果方法确实奏效,请一定回复点赞哦,给后来人也是一种帮助,谢谢!
派生类在构造的时候,会先调用基类的构造函数。
如果,基类构造函数参数列表为空,那么不需要给该函数传参。
如:
CMe::CMe(){cout<<"CMe Be Called"<<endl;}
那么,若有
class CMySon: public CMe{public:CMySon(int times,char * son);};
则CMySon的定义只需这样:
CMySon::CMySon(int times,char * son){cout<<"CMySon Be Called"<<endl;}
如果基类构造函数带参,像这样:
CMe::CMe(char * son){cout<<"CMe Be Called"<<endl;}那么,派生类构造函数需要向基类构造函数传递参数:
CMySon::CMySon(int times,char * son):CMe(son){cout<<"CMySon Be Called"<<endl;}如果不加:CMe(son)则会产生no appropriate default constructor available的编译错误
- 【error C2512】VC++编译错误 no appropriate default constructor available
- VC中编译错误 no appropriate default constructor available【error C2512】
- error C2512: \'CSample\' : no appropriate default constructor available
- C2512 : no appropriate default constructor available 的另一种错误原因
- vc++ 编译错误“no appropriate default constructor available”解决方法
- vc++ 编译错误“no appropriate default constructor available”解决方法
- C2512: no appropriate default constructor availabl
- no appropriate default constructor available
- no appropriate default constructor available
- f:\arm\program\point\point\point.cpp(24) : error C2512: 'Time' : no appropriate default constructor
- VC 之定义类变量时出现 no appropriate default constructor available
- There is no default constructor available in xxx错误引发
- there is no default constructor available in ...
- 错误总结之no appropriate constructor in class
- 关于has no default constructor的错误
- dvips Error:-no default destination available
- boost的一个错误error C2512
- error C2558:no copy constructor available or copy constructor is declared 'explicit'
- 公钥和私钥及数字签名
- Linux 修改用户密码常见提示以及对应的解决方法
- Win7环境下在VirtualBox中安装Ubuntu 11.10后设置文件夹共享
- hadoop HDFS详解
- LDD3 读书笔记---设备驱动简介
- 【error C2512】VC++编译错误 no appropriate default constructor available
- Not an ISO 8859-1 character 不存在 ISO 8859-1 编码的字符
- Java compiler level does not match the version of the installed Java project facet.
- 几款图形数据生成插件
- servlet cookie得不到值问题
- 【研发管理】如何向开源社区提问题
- 厚积薄发,丰富的公用类库积累,助你高效进行系统开发(14)---Winform开发的常用类库(终结篇,CHM文档放送)
- #if defined(__cplusplus)
- Java Random类的使用